Nettet20. mar. 2024 · The second reason clients leave financial advisors is related to the first. “It’s pretty clear when a client leaves that the perceived value they were getting from an advisor no longer meets their goals,” says Charles Bender, owner of Miami-based investment advisory firm Fiduciary Wealth Management.
